Moulvibajar: Two Muslim devotees died at an ijtema ground in the district early Saturday.
Motu Miah, 65, a resident of Gangkul village, and Surnam Uddin, 55, hailing from Boro Moidan village in Barlakhe upazila , died at the ijtema ground in Jagannathpur area due to old-age complications, said Muhibur Rahman, an assistant sub-inspector of Moulvibazar Police Station.
The three-day ijtema began at Uposhahar ijtema ground through Aam Boyan after Fazr prayers on Thursday.
The ijtema is set to end today through Akheri Munajat.
